Legal fees vary based on the complexity of your specific immigration status. Factors like prior visa history, criminal background, or the specific type of petition—such as family sponsorship versus employment-based adjustment—shift the workload significantly. If you have missing documentation or need to file waivers, the legal effort increases, which impacts the final bill. Immigration lawyers help you understand and navigate U.S. immigration laws. They can assist with applications, petitions, and represent you in legal proceedings. For residents in Santa Clarita, this means guidance on everything from green cards to citizenship. They ensure all your paperwork is correct and submitted on time.

Immigration lawyers handle a wide range of services, from advising on visa eligibility to preparing and filing necessary documents. They can represent you in immigration court or with USCIS.
